Output 4ab63b61e407223f646529c77197d3f05bc7a83476391abe2f1b279c82815e7d:0

value
3970294
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ada1659fc4626f0d7006b06e943fb3b2d7b32ed OP_EQUALVERIFY OP_CHECKSIG
address
1AjytJkRfTDcCsyZyBMRT1XNC3zvxpTyPC
transaction
4ab63b61e407223f646529c77197d3f05bc7a83476391abe2f1b279c82815e7d
confirmations
573022
spent
true